Mutual of America Capital Management LLC trimmed its position in National Fuel Gas Company (NYSE:NFG – Free Report) by 3.6% during the second qu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 44,932 shares of the oil and gas producer’s stock after selling 1,673 shares during the quarter. Mutual of America Capital Management LLC’s holdings in National Fuel Gas were worth $3,806,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

National Fuel Gas (NYSE:NFG –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 30th. The oil and gas producer reported $1.64 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.50 by $0.14. The business had revenue of $531.83 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$596.12 million. National Fuel Gas had a return on equity of 20.81% and a net margin of 11.15%.The business’s revenue was up 27.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.99 EPS. National Fuel Gas has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.000-8.500 EPS. FY 2025 guidance at 6.800-6.950 EPS. Equities research analysts expect that National Fuel Gas Company will post 6.64 EPS for the current year.

About National Fuel Gas
National Fuel Gas Company operates as a diversified energy company. It operates through four segments: Exploration and Production, Pipeline and Storage, Gathering, and Utility. The Exploration and Production segment explores for, develops, and produces natural gas and oil. The Pipeline and Storage segment provides interstate natural gas transportation services through an integrated gas pipeline system in Pennsylvania and New York; and owns and operates underground natural gas storage fields.
